Additional Notes
List of recognizance.
First and second defendants: John Jordan or John Jorton, Henry Hains or Henry Hiens.
Charged with stealing hay from the meadow of James Gibbens.
Additional names: Samuel Boyd, Jacob Carpenter.
Third defendant: John Dennis.
Charged with forcible entry and stealing hay out of meadow of Henry Hains or Henry Hiens.
Additional name: James Gibbens.
Fourth defendant: James Gibbens.
Charged with assault and battery of Henry Hains or Henry Hiens.
Additional name: John Jordan or John Jorton.

Additional Notes
List of recognizance.
First defendant: Henry Hains.
Charged with forcible entry and cutting the grass from the meadow of James Gibbens.
Additional name: Martin Carpenter.
Second defendants: John Kentle and Aron Musgrove.
Charged with forcible entry in meadow of Henry Hains.
Additional name: James Gibbens.
Third and fourth defendants: John Jordan, Isaac Davis
Charged with forcible entry in meadow and cutting grass of James Gibbens.
Additional names: Samuel Boyd, John Jordan.
